Job Summary
The Head of Department is responsible for the disciplinary and technical leadership of the Piping Discipline, ensuring successful project execution and positive project results.
Key responsibilities include managing team performance, resource allocation, technical governance, interdisciplinary coordination, operational excellence, standardization, and budget management for the Piping department.
The role requires extensive experience in Piping Engineering within the oil & gas, chemical, or energy sectors, with proven knowledge of project execution in the EPC Industry and experience in project or line management.
